City Council Regular Meeting Minutes <br /> June 26, 2001 <br /> Page 7 <br /> 1 B. Resolution 01-068, re: Order preparation of report on 2002 street and utility <br /> 2 improvements (Todd Hubmer, WSB & Associates, Inc. will be present.). <br /> 3 City Manager Mike Momson introduced Todd Hubmer, WSB & Associates. Mr. Hubmer stated <br /> 4 that what is proposed for 2002 is the reconstruction of Wilson Street from 30`h Avenue Northeast <br /> 5 to 32nd Avenue Northeast; Harding Street, from 30`h Avenue Northeast to 3151 Avenue <br /> 6 Northeast; 31" Avenue Northeast, from Wilson Street to Silver Lake Road; and intersection <br /> 7 work at Edward Street, Belden Drive and 32"d Avenue. <br /> 8 Mr. Hubmer stated the purpose for this year's reconstruction will include replacement of <br /> 9 watermain and replacement of sanitary where it is needed and in areas where it will conflict with <br /> 10 the new storm sewer system. He reviewed the specifics and the proposed schedule for the 2002 <br /> 11 project, with an anticipated completion in September 2002, with a final pavement in 2003. <br /> 12 Councilmember Thuesen asked about the narrowness of 3151 Avenue by St. Mary's Russian <br /> 13 Greek Orthodox Catholic Church Cemetery and whether, or not, there are any plans on what can <br /> 14 be done. Mr. Hubmer stated that they have begun conversations with them and that there are a <br /> 15 number of issues associated with the cemetery. He added that were going to work with the <br /> 16 cemetery and try to acquire some land back from them in order to widen the road back the <br /> 17 original width. <br /> 18 Councilmember Hodson asked if they have taken the underground electrical situation that may <br /> 19 be tied to the reconstruction into consideration. Mr. Hubmer stated that they have considered <br /> 20 that, and that the City needs to determine if they want to spend the money. <br /> 21 Motion by Councilmember Hodson to adopt Resolution 01-068, re: Order preparation of report <br /> 22 on 2002 street and utility.improvements. <br /> 23 Motion carried unanimously. <br /> 24 C. Resolution 01-067 re: Wellhead protection plan proposal from WSB & Associates (Todd <br /> 25 Hubmer, WSB & Associates, Inc. will be present). <br /> 26 Mr. Hubmer stated that he and Jay Hartman attended a meeting on May 8, 2001,at the request of <br /> 27 the Minnesota Department of Health which was a formal notification process to the City of St. <br /> 28 Anthony that must begin the Wellhead Planning Protection Process. He added that it is a <br /> 29 requirement for the State of Minnesota, and that it has to be completed within the next three <br /> 30 years. <br /> 31 Mr. Hubmer indicated it was a two-phase completion: background information phase to collect <br /> 32 groundwater information that they can, as they believe a lot of the information has already been <br /> 33 done, but needs to be collaborated, and an examination of the City's water supply to determine <br /> 34 what types of policies need to be developed for land use.
